ZBlogPHP是一款轻量级博客程序,用户可便捷地创建和管理博客,如需自定义404页面,请按以下步骤操作:首先登录ZBlog后台,进入“设计”选项卡,找到“404错误页面”,点击“编辑”并输入自定义内容,在模板文件中加入代码,如“header.php”和“footer.php”,设置导航、标题和链接,清空缓存,预览404页面效果,确认一切正常后保存更改。
在数字时代,网站对于个人和企业而言至关重要,作为信息交流的平台,一个网站不仅要有美观的设计,更要有功能完备且用户友好的体验,当用户尝试访问不存在的页面时,网页浏览器通常会显示默认的404错误页面,这不仅对用户造成困扰,也可能损害网站的权威性和专业形象,对于使用ZBlogPHP框架构建的个人博客而言,创建一个自定义的404页面是一项基本而重要的任务,以下将详细介绍如何在ZBlogPHP中添加自定义404页面。
理解404错误及其重要性
404错误是HTTP状态码之一,表示客户端请求的资源在服务器上不存在或无法被找到,它是网站用户体验的关键组成部分,一个好的404页面不仅可以提供有用的导航信息帮助用户返回到网站的其他部分,还能够展示网站的个性和风格。
准备工作
在进行任何自定义操作之前,确保已经备份了当前的ZBlogPHP安装,以防出现意外情况,了解ZBlogPHP的文件结构和目录布局也非常重要,因为这直接关系到后续步骤的执行。
创建自定义404页面
-
新建页面文件
在ZBlogPHP的根目录下,找到并打开
application/layout文件夹,在此文件夹中创建一个名为php的新文件。 -
设计页面内容
打开
php文件,开始设计自定义404页面的内容,可以使用HTML、CSS和PHP来实现所需的效果,确保页面布局整洁、易于导航,并包含一些描述性的文本或图像来增强用户体验。 -
设置重定向
为了让用户能够顺利返回到网站的其他部分,在
php文件的底部添加以下代码:<?php if (isset($_SERVER['REQUEST_URI'])) { $uri = parse_url($_SERVER['REQUEST_URI'], PHP_URL_PATH); if ($uri !== '/' && file_exists('application/layout/' . $uri . '.php')) { header('Location: ' . $uri); exit; } } ?>这段代码会检查用户请求的URI是否指向一个有效的页面文件,如果找到了对应的文件,则将用户重定向到该页面。
测试自定义404页面
完成上述步骤后,通过浏览器访问一个不存在的页面来测试自定义404页面是否按预期工作,如果一切正常,用户将被重定向到网站的其他部分或首页。
注意事项
-
保持页面简洁
由于404页面是用户在网站遇到错误时的最后接触点,请确保页面简洁明了、易于理解,避免使用过多的复杂布局和脚本代码。
-
定期备份
定期备份自定义404页面和其他重要文件,以防出现需要紧急恢复的情况。
-
更新维护
当网站结构或内容发生变化时,请记得更新自定义404页面以保持其有效性。
通过以上步骤,你不仅能够为ZBlogPHP网站添加一个美观且实用的自定义404页面,还能够提升用户体验和网站的专业形象。


还没有评论,来说两句吧...